Real Madrid is playing an away match in the second round of the UEFA Champions League against Lille, where a historic event took place for the club.
Details: As reported by AS, Brazilian forward Endrick became the youngest player in Real Madrid's history to take the field in the UEFA Champions League. At this moment, he is 18 years and 73 days old, surpassing the legendary forward Raúl, who made his debut at 18 years and 78 days in a match against Ajax.
Endrick has already scored two goals for Real Madrid, first in a match against Valladolid and then in the game against Stuttgart in the Champions League.
